Hagar, Peters Confirmed for AVP 2

Back in October Superhero Hype posted a brief report that Kristen Hagar, a relative newcomer, was cast in Alien vs. Predator 2, creating some discussion as to who exactly she was, and which role she had landed. I can now confirm, through my own independent sources, that Hagar will indeed play one of the leading roles, a character named Jesse (as we had speculated in our own report on the heels of SHH).

To this point Hagar has made her way working in television, starring in various mini-series and made-for-television movies. She will be making her big screen debut next year in the Bob Dylan biographic I'm Not There, opposite Cate Blanchette, Adrien Brody, Richard Gere, Heath Ledger, Julianne Moore, and Batman himself, Christian Bale.

Also confirmed is the equally young and unknown Meshach Peters, who is on as Curtis, a non-lead character.

Peters, a native of Ontario, Canada, can be seen playing a small role in the Ben Stiller comedy, Night at the Museum, which opened in theatres December 22nd. He can also be seen playing Kevin in the science-fiction series Eureka, and next year in the straight-to-video release The Sandlot 3.

Stan Winston may have built the creatures and designed the Predators (H.R. Geiger designed the Alien), but he has no investment in the rights of them. Those are owned wholly by 20th Century Fox.

I wish Fox took better care of their franchises. These films were individually successful as "R" rated films. Why do a PG-13 sequel? Although, I think a good film can be done inside of a PG-13 rating if they actually tied their films into the respected franchises that spawned them.
